Implement proper caching using expiration dates in the response headers.

Currently, you skip the step of resizing the image which is good. However, the image is streamed to the browser without expiration headers, causing the image to be requested and streamed back from ...

Id #191 | Release: None | Updated: Feb 1, 2013 at 11:42 PM by webudvikler | Created: Mar 27, 2011 at 7:21 PM by webudvikler

Change the implementation of DefaultImagePath and DefaultImagePathCache so they support virtual root based paths as well

(e.g. ~/Images as well as C:\Sites\MySite\Images)

Id #190 | Release: None | Updated: Feb 1, 2013 at 11:42 PM by webudvikler | Created: Mar 27, 2011 at 7:20 PM by webudvikler

Provide an option to influence scaling

(e.g. whether or not to scale up or down, maintain aspect ratio, force a specific size and so on).

Id #189 | Release: None | Updated: Feb 1, 2013 at 11:42 PM by webudvikler | Created: Mar 27, 2011 at 7:19 PM by webudvikler

Provide an OutputType option.

So we're not stuck to jpg

Id #188 | Release: None | Updated: Feb 1, 2013 at 11:42 PM by webudvikler | Created: Mar 27, 2011 at 7:19 PM by webudvikler

Introduce using statements on IDisposable objects.

Current implementation is open to memory leaks and file locks.

Id #187 | Release: None | Updated: Feb 1, 2013 at 11:42 PM by webudvikler | Created: Mar 27, 2011 at 7:19 PM by webudvikler

Fix the API to follow .NET Guidelines

So you have GetImage instead of getImage, AlternateImageName instead of AlternateImagename, and so on.

Id #186 | Release: Image Server 1.0.1 | Updated: Jun 4, 2013 at 1:32 AM by webudvikler | Created: Mar 27, 2011 at 7:11 PM by webudvikler

  • 1-6 of 6 Work Items
    • Previous
    • 1
    • Next
    • Showing
    • All
    • Work Items